The data in TeleChart needs to be cleaned up.

Of the 6943 symbols listed in All Stocks 167 (2.4%) do not have Industry Groups assigned to them.

Of the same 6943 symbols 176 (2.5%) appear to have flat-lined. Some, such as AORGB went inactive in mid May. Some, such as CAFE are inactive due to SEC issues. Some, such as VRTS were bought out and are no longer valid.

The bottom line is that more than 4% of the symbols are affecting the accuracy of the Industry Group rankings and sector rotation standings.

One would think that an important part of the Worden’s Data Department’s duties would be to ensure that the data provided from the data vendor is clean and accurate for TeleChart subscribers.

In order for a stock to display an EPS change in TeleChart it must move from positive to another positive earnings value. These stocks either moved from negative to negative or negative to positive. Once they move from positive to positive they will begin to display EPS percent changes.

It's the latest 4 quarters. Here is the definition from the help file:

EPS Percent Change (Latest Yr)
The percentage change in earnings for the latest 4 quarters compared to the preceding 4 quarters. An appropriate criterion to include in many types of screens. Also a common criterion to sort by, with the best earners on top.

It is not an opinion but industry standard that our vendor is applying. It is the math that does not work on certain calculations. Let's look at PDFS as an example. I have copied the raw EPS data from our vendor to show calculations on the lastest two quarters.

EPS %Change Latest Quarter
.06-.01=.05
0.05/0.01 = 5 or 500% (as reported in program)

EPS %Change 2nd Quarter Back
.05 - (-.02) = .07
.07/(-.02) = (-3.5) or -350%

As shown here, the calculation for percent change shows a -350%. The only way to render a positive is to apply an absolute value to the denominator and GAAP standards do not use that method.
